10 Super-Cool Reclaimed & Recycled Home Decor Ideas
What's better than home decor that is eco-friendly, has a cool story behind it, boasts a rustic air, and still has a sleek, modern vibe to it?
Well, there isn't much better in our book, especially when it comes to what's trendy in Colorado home design. Take a look at these rustic-chic pieces, crafted from the most unsuspecting raw materials, and be inspired by the transformation from old and demolished to new and cool.


1. A CLOCK MADE OUT OF BICYCLE CHAIN RINGS

2. A DRESSER MADE OF WOOD TAKEN FROM URBAN DEMOLITION PROJECTS


3. THROW BLANKETS MADE OUT OF RECYCLED COTTON


4. PILLOWS MADE OUT OF RECLAIMED BURLAP COFFEE BAGS & MILITARY CANVAS ARMY TENTS

5. COASTERS MADE OUT OF SCRAP WOOD


6. A BAR OR SIDEBOARD MADE OF RECLAIMED WOOD

7. CHAIRS MADE OUT OF REPURPOSED STREET SIGNS

8. A WINE RACK MADE OUT OF THE MAPLE FROM OLD BOXCARS

9. BAR STOOLS MADE FROM REPURPOSED OAK BOXCAR FLOORING

10. A RUSTIC BED MADE FROM RECLAIMED WOOD
